Nhanganyaya
The TOMLOV DM702 Flex-S is a versatile 10.1-inch digital microscope system designed for detailed observation and precision work, particularly in electronics repair, soldering, and coin examination. It features a flexible boom arm, a large display, and integrated helping hands with a ring light, providing an ergonomic and efficient workspace.

Operating Instruction
Basic Operation
- Batidza/Kudzima: Press and hold the power button on the LCD screen to turn the unit on or off.
- Focus Adjustment: Rotate the focus wheel on the microscope body to achieve a clear image of your subject on the screen.
- Kukudza: Adjust the distance between the microscope lens and the object to change the magnification level. The DM702 Flex-S offers up to 1300X magnification.
- Kudzora Mwenje weRing: The integrated LED ring light can be adjusted for brightness to ensure optimal illumination of your subject.

Kugadzirisa matambudziko
| Dambudziko | Zvinogona Kukonzera | Solution |
|---|---|---|
| Hapana mufananidzo pascreen. | Not powered on; loose cable; lens cap on. | Ensure power is connected and unit is on; check all cable connections; remove lens cap. |
| Mufananidzo hauna kujeka. | Out of focus; incorrect working distance. | Adjust the focus wheel; change the distance between the lens and the object. |
| Cannot capture photos/videos. | No MicroSD card; card full; card error. | Insert MicroSD card; delete unnecessary files; format card (backup data first). |
| Ring light not working. | Light is off; power issue. | Check light settings in menu; ensure power connection is stable. |
